Donald Trump said Ukraine will receive sophisticated military equipment sold to Europeans, who will then transfer it to Kiev.

Following a meeting with NATO Secretary General Mark Rutte, Donald Trump announced that Ukraine will benefit from a large number of sophisticated military equipment following an agreement between NATO and the US. These weapons will be sold to European countries, which will transfer them to Ukraine. Trump emphasized that the costs will be borne by NATO member states, not US taxpayers. He also threatened Russia's allies with severe tariffs if a deal in the Ukraine war is not reached within 50 days.
